I downloaded the spreadsheet and went to the worksheet appropriate for me, which turned out to be Super Blue. My goal is to achieve a 50% mix, using -20 blue wwf and Heet. A couple of observations:
I was told the -20 blue wwf was 30% methanol, which is what I used when I determined the quantities. I used Peak -20, which it shows as 37%. Not a big deal, just increases my mixture to 54% methanol.
The parameter Total Volume of Mix went to 1.4 Gallons and stayed there, even though my quantities (4 gallons of Peak, 3 12 oz. of Heet) were closer to 5 gallons.
When I set the parameters to my original values (4 gallons @ 30%, 3 bottles of Heet) it calculated 49% methanol, which is what I got when I calculated it myself.

Sounds good. I went through his equations; he was not adding the original wwf amount to the Heet amount to find the total volume. I converted everything to ounces, added them together, then converted back to gallons. My answer was correct at that point.
I followed the msds % by weight to try to find his % by volume. He is corrrect for Peak, if you count <33% by volume as being =33% by volume. Which means that I am running a bit more methanol than I first thought. Oh darn!
